SUPERSTAR EBiDAN Mod is a licensed rhythm game centered on the Japanese idol group EBiDAN. Players tap notes in sync with the group's music tracks to score points, collect character cards, and participate in events. The target audience is fans of the group and players seeking a specific idol-themed rhythm experience rather than a general music game.
